On 08/09/15 17:47, Adi Kriegisch wrote:

There is a bug in Lightning[0] for which a patch exists[1] and a nightly
build is available[2] (without localization and all that). The Mozilla
Lightning team will roll out an updated Lightning version real soon now or
in two weeks -- depending on whom you ask. (And I have no idea if this will
be v4.0.2.1 or v4.0.3).


Adi, many thanks for your thorough and most helpful reply.  I now 
understand that any outage of the CalDAV connection will cause the 
current Lightning plug-in to mark it as disabled.  I don't use US 
English, so will wait for the next official release before re-testing.


I use OCSP stapling on all my Apache servers and have for some time.  
All seems to be functioning correctly there but the StartCom StartSSL 
OCSP server is very unreliable of late.  If the server needs to verify 
the certificate (because the cached response has expired) and their 
server is unreachable it passes this information to the client.  
Thunderbird interprets this as an insecure connection and blocks access 
to the web server temporarily.  This then triggers the Lightning bug and 
calendars vanish.

My calendars locked again yesterday.  The trick of changing their 
readonly and disabled status via the configuration editor and then 
restarting Thunderbird once again fixed them.  This time I was able to 
copy the errors from the Thunderbird log (attached) and match them to 
Apache errors on my SOGo server caused by the StartCom OCSP server being 
off-line once more.


It looks like, in my case at least, this is the connection.  Anyone else 
able to verify this based on my last information and their Apache logs?


Hunting through Thunderbird I have now found in Preferences -> Advanced 
-> Certificates that there is a "Query OCSP responder servers to confirm 
the current validity of certificates" setting. It is enabled on my 
installation and I am going to disable it to see if it helps.  As OCSP 
stapling on my Apache (SOGo) server should do this verification, my 
belief is that having the client do it too is redundant.  Certainly 
Google have retired this feature from their Chrome browser, so they 
clearly don't see the value.

Re: [SOGo] Calendars locked

2015-09-02 Thread Charles Marcus
Tools > Options > Advanced > General > Config Editor

Maximize the window, then filter on "calendar.reg" (minus the quotes)

Look for two entries for each calendar:

calendar.registry.X.disabled
calendar.registry.X.readOnly

where X is a string associated with the SOGO internal calendar ID.

Dbl-click the .disabled entry to re-enable it.

IF the Calendar is supposed to be writeable, then do the same for the
readOnly entry.

The name for each Calendar will be between these two entries for each
one (see attached screenshot).

Note: Don't change the readOnly setting if the Calendar is, in fact,
supposed to be readOnly.

This has fixed it for me on multiple systems.

[SOGo] Calendars locked

2015-08-31 Thread Bob Wooldridge
One of my users this morning has all their calendars locked.  Both their 
personal calendar and other calendars they are subscribed to. This is in 
Thunderbird (38.2) but the SOGo web interface seems to be working fine.  
If I try to sync or reload, nothing happens.


Any ideas what to do and what has caused this?

Hey!

> One of my users this morning has all their calendars locked.  Both
> their personal calendar and other calendars they are subscribed to.
> This is in Thunderbird (38.2) but the SOGo web interface seems to be
> working fine.  If I try to sync or reload, nothing happens.
> 
> Any ideas what to do and what has caused this?
In our case lightning was stuck at version 4.0.0.X (due to us pinning the
lightning version). After we allowed the upgrade to 4.0.2 calendars were
still disabled and read-only; we had to manually reenable the calendars and
set them read-write where appropriate directly in the config editor.
